Position Summary
The Advanced Practice Nurse Educator (APNE) is a member of Collaborative Academic Practice & Practice-Based Education portfolios. The APNE aligns with unit interdisciplinary leadership teams and demonstrates a set of core competencies fundamental to developing and maintaining the academic practice environment at UHN. The APNE role involves enhancing patient care by applying evidence-based practices providing clinical consultation and addressing gaps in practice. The APNE uses best practice in education to assess learning needs develop design deliver and evaluate educational programs.
Duties
- Design and deliver tailored staff education
- Promote professional development and mentors nurses for career growth
- Collaborate with teams across UHN and the academic community on clinical and educational initiatives
- Participate in committees and share best practices
- Lead program evaluation implement innovative education strategies and support and lead quality improvement initiatives
- Drive nursing visibility and change management efforts ensuring compliance with health and safety regulations
Qualifications :
- Completion of a Masters degree program in Nursing or Education or recognized equivalent is required
- Completion of specialty-specific certification program(s) relevant to respective clinical areas
- Critical Care Experience required
- At least three (3) years of recent nursing experience in a critical care unit
- Theoretical and practical experience in adult education including learning needs assessment educational program planning development and evaluation an asset
- Previous experience as an Educator is an asset
- Knowledge of nursing care of neurology and neurosurgical patient is considered an asset
- Current certificate of licensure/registration with the College of Nurses of Ontario
- Completion of a Basic Cardiac Life Support (B.C.L.S.) program Level II: Basic Rescuer certification
- Current membership in RNAO (Registered Nurses Association of Ontario) is preferred
- Current membership in a related professional interest group or association is preferred
- Excellent leadership time management presentation skills
- Ability to be adaptable build trust provide coaching and collaboration facilitate change and promote continuous improvement
- Demonstrate ability to motivate staff and create an environment conducive to learning and team building
- Sound knowledge base in areas of specialty and the education process
- Able to work effectively as a member of an interdisciplinary team
- Competence in use of information technology
- Ability to meet multiple and competing deadlines
